What is Tertiary Ammonia Filtration?

Tertiary ammonia filtration represents an advanced stage in wastewater treatment, specifically targeting ammonia nitrogen removal through amine-based chemical processes. Unlike conventional biological methods, these systems employ selective adsorption technology to convert ammonia into biodegradable compounds, offering superior efficiency and operational flexibility. The technology has become indispensable for industries requiring compliance with stringent discharge limits, particularly in chemical processing, semiconductor manufacturing, and municipal water treatment plants.

Key Market Drivers

1. Regulatory Pressure on Industrial Wastewater Discharge
Environmental agencies worldwide are tightening ammonia emission standards, with the U.S. EPA and European Environment Agency implementing strict limits on nitrogen compounds in industrial effluent. Recent amendments to the Clean Water Act have reduced permissible ammonia levels by 30% for key industries, compelling facilities to upgrade to tertiary treatment systems. Municipalities facing nutrient pollution challenges are similarly adopting these technologies to prevent eutrophication in sensitive water bodies.

2. Industrial Expansion and Water Stress Conditions
Rapid industrialization in emerging economies combined with freshwater scarcity is accelerating adoption of advanced filtration solutions. The semiconductor sector's expansion across Asia-Pacific has created particularly strong demand, as chip fabrication requires ultrapure water with ammonia concentrations below 0.1 ppm. Meanwhile, growing recognition of water reuse potential encourages manufacturers to implement closed-loop systems incorporating tertiary ammonia removal.

Technology Advancements

The market benefits from continuous innovation across three key technology domains:

  • Modular System Designs: Pre-engineered, skid-mounted units that reduce installation timelines by 40% compared to conventional systems
  • Advanced Media Formulations: Next-generation ion exchange resins with 30% higher ammonia capacity and improved regeneration efficiency
  • Smart Monitoring: IoT-enabled sensors providing real-time ammonia tracking and predictive maintenance capabilities

Market Challenges

  • High Capital Requirements: Complete tertiary filtration systems for mid-sized industrial plants typically require $500,000-$2 million initial investment
  • Specialized Maintenance Needs: Operations require certified water treatment technicians, creating staffing challenges in remote locations
  • Competing Technologies: Alternative nitrogen removal methods like anaerobic ammonium oxidation (anammox) pose substitution threats in some applications

Emerging Opportunities

The circular economy movement creates promising avenues for market expansion through ammonia recovery and reuse:

  • Agricultural Applications: Recovered ammonia finds value as liquid fertilizer, offsetting treatment costs
  • Industrial Byproduct Utilization: Captured ammonia serves as feedstock for chemical manufacturing processes
  • Carbon Credit Potential: Systems demonstrating measurable greenhouse gas reductions may qualify for environmental credits
